Abstract
A machining thermostatic control system and method of using the same are disclosed. The system comprises a detecting unit, a processing unit and at least a cooling unit. The detecting unit is used for detecting the temperature distribution of a workpiece. The processing unit is coupled to the detecting unit and is used for processing the temperature distribution for obtaining a position of maximum hot spot of the workpiece. The cooling unit comprises a head which is provided for discharging cooling fluid and a plurality of blades which are angle-adjustably mounted to the head. The blades are coupled to the processing unit and the angle of blades are controlled by the processing unit for enabling the cooling fluid to flow toward to the position of maximum hot spot position.

(27) To sum up, the focus point of the present disclosure is to develop a machining thermostatic control system and a method of using the same, and more particularly, to a machining thermostatic control system capable of reducing thermal error by using a temperature signal that is obtained from a means of temperature calculation to adjust outlet direction, flow and temperature of a cooling fluid for enabling a heat exchanging operation to happen at a position of maximum hot spot of a workpiece that is being machined at a high speed. Consequently, the high-temperature of the machining workpiece can be detected effectively, temperature raising of the machining workpiece can be reduced effectively, thermal error can be decreased, the effectiveness of the flowing cooling fluid is improved and the structure deformation caused by temperature variation is minimized.
(28) It is noted that all the infrared thermometers that are currently available on the market can only detect and display temperatures and are not designed to perform any posterior processes using the detected temperature values. In another word, the detecting unit in the present disclosure is not simply a device for detecting and displaying temperature, but is a device composed of a plurality of sensors that are coupled to the processing unit, by that the processing unit is able perform an calculation/analysis to obtain a position of maximum hot spot so as to use the temperature of the position of maximum hot spot to adjust the orientation of the cooling unit and the flow and temperature of the cooling fluid.
